基于一站式网上服务大厅的工程学院信息管理系统设计与实现
2025-05-02 07:47
在信息化时代,高校需要高效的信息管理系统来提升教学与管理效率。本文以“一站式网上服务大厅”为基础平台,开发了面向工程学院的信息管理系统。该系统旨在整合教务管理、师生互动及资源分配等多方面功能。
系统架构采用三层模式:表现层、业务逻辑层和数据访问层。前端使用HTML5+CSS3技术构建响应式界面,后端则基于Java Spring Boot框架开发,数据库选用MySQL。通过RESTful API实现前后端分离。

下面展示部分关键代码片段:
// 学生实体类
public class Student {
private Long id;
private String name;
private String major;
// Getters and Setters
}
// 数据库配置文件 application.properties
spring.datasource.url=jdbc:mysql://localhost:3306/engineering_college
spring.datasource.username=root
spring.datasource.password=123456
// 教师查询接口
@RestController
@RequestMapping("/teacher")
public class TeacherController {
@Autowired
private TeacherService teacherService;
@GetMapping("/{id}")
public ResponseEntity getTeacher(@PathVariable Long id) {
return ResponseEntity.ok(teacherService.findById(id));
}
}
该系统还集成了在线选课模块,允许学生根据专业方向选择课程,并实时更新学分情况。同时,管理员可通过后台对课程表进行维护。
总结而言,“一站式网上服务大厅”为高校提供了便捷的服务入口,而工程学院信息管理系统则进一步提升了学院内部的运行效率,具有重要的实践意义。
]]>
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:一站式网上服务大厅

